Kit


Sample type Cell culture supernatant; Serum; Plasma
Assay type Sandwich (quantitative)
Range Human IL-2: 7.81 pg/mL – 500 pg/mL
Human IL-6: 0.78 pg/mL – 50 pg/mL
Human TNF-α: 7.81 pg/mL – 500 pg/mL
Human IFN-γ: 3.13 pg/mL – 200 pg/mL
Recovery Human IFN-γ
Assay time 60 minutes

Background

Human IL-2, IL-6, TNF-α, and IFN-γ are key cytokines that orchestrate diverse immune functions, ranging from T cell regulation to inflammation and antimicrobial defense. IL-2, produced mainly by activated T cells, drives T cell proliferation and supports regulatory T cell survival, making it critical for immune homeostasis and cancer immunotherapy. IL-6 is a pleiotropic cytokine secreted by immune and stromal cells; it induces acute-phase responses and B cell differentiation but can also fuel chronic inflammation and cytokine storms when dysregulated. TNF-α, a major pro-inflammatory cytokine from macrophages and T cells, mediates fever, apoptosis, and cachexia, and is a primary therapeutic target in autoimmune diseases such as rheumatoid arthritis. IFN-γ, the sole type II interferon, is produced by natural killer cells and T lymphocytes; it activates macrophages, enhances antigen presentation, and directs cell-mediated immunity against intracellular pathogens. Together, these four cytokines form an interconnected network that balances immune activation, inflammation, and host defense.

Linearity
The concentrations of Human IL-2 were measured and interpolated from the target standard curves and corrected for sample dilution.
The sample is undiluted samples are as follows:  Jurkat T cells stimulated with 10 ng/ml PMA and 150 ng/ml A23187 for 24 h (10%). The interpolated dilution factor corrected values are plotted. The mean target concentration was determined to be 3160.45 pg/mL in stimulated Jurkat supernatant.

Linearity
The concentrations of Human IL-6 were measured and interpolated from the target standard curves and corrected for sample dilution.
The sample is undiluted samples are as follows:  human PBMC cells stimulated with 10ug/ml PHA for 5 days (0.16%). The interpolated dilution factor corrected values are plotted. The mean target concentration was determined to be 38252.05 pg/mL in stimulated human PBMC supernatant.

Linearity
The concentrations of Human TNF-α were measured and interpolated from the target standard curves and corrected for sample dilution.
The sample is undiluted samples are as follows:  human PBMC cells stimulated with 10ug/ml PHA for 5 days (10%). The interpolated dilution factor corrected values are plotted. The mean target concentration was determined to be 6362.08 pg/mL in stimulated human PBMC supernatant.

Linearity
The concentrations of Human IFN-γ were measured and interpolated from the target standard curves and corrected for sample dilution.
The sample is undiluted samples are as follows:  human PBMC cells stimulated with 10ug/ml PHA for 5 days (2.5%). The interpolated dilution factor corrected values are plotted. The mean target concentration was determined to be 10054.28 pg/mL in stimulated human PBMC supernatant.
